On Blister Cinematic, we talk about the craziest — and arguably the greatest — snowboard / ski / monoski / snowblade film of all time, Apocalypse Snow. This 26-minute film was seen by millions of people when it came out, and nearly 40 years later, it still feels wildly innovative, fresh, and amazing. Joining me to dive deep into this glorious, apocalyptic feature is Mountain Gazette owner & editor, Mike Rogge, and, the strikingly handsome Justin Bobb.

On our Blister Cinematic podcast, we’re discussing The Blackcountry Journal, a new, truly different, 10-minute-long film by Mallory Duncan that packs a lot into its short running length, bringing together the worlds of jazz and skiing in ways you’ve never seen, and incorporating ideas, words, and scenes that you won’t soon forget.

For episode #1 of Blister Cinematic, Cody and Jonathan dissect the 2011 film, G.N.A.R., and discuss the significance of the film; what’s aged the best; what’s aged the worst; who won the movie; and more.
